Help needed in Christchurch?

Not often I’d repost anything from Kiwiblog, but I’ll make an exception for this:

Tom Young, who is working with Sam Johnson, on the student volunteer clean-up of affected Christchurch properties has e-mailed:

At the moment we basically have the problem that we have a lot of volunteers willing and able to help, but not enough jobs to do. I’m just wondering if any of your readers know of any properties in the Christchurch region that need a hand, we`re predominately moving silt and other earthquake related rubbish from properties. If your readers know of any properties which have this sort of damage we can help if they email sam@samjohnson.co.nz, describing the problem, their address and a contact number. If no-one is home it would be good if the owners put a note on the door giving permission for us to do the work as well.

So if any readers are in Christchurch, and would like some student help, or know someone who would – just e-mail Sam.

Well done Sam and the Christchurch students! Dunedin students are also planning to lend a hand. When so much of the media coverage of students is of the negative (drunken sofa-burning) variety, it’s great to see some of the many positive things that students do being recognised this time.
